There was a (now lost) show called The Gallery of Madame Liu-Tsong starring Anna Wong on the (long-defunct) DuMont Network. It aired 10 episodes in 1951. It's the first ever American tv show to star an AAPI woman and the first detective show to star a minority of group.

This guy is Capt. Britain (Brian Braddock) in his first costume. He had a series in the UK that came to be written/drawn by Alan Moore and Alan Smith which is most known for introducing Psylocke (his twin sister).
The guy you're thinking of is Guardian (James Hudson), also known as Vindicator.
